REX FEATURES Romelu Lukaku is set to skip his court date in Los Angeles Romelu Lukaku was arrested after "excessive noise" at his Beverly Hills holiday home Lukaku , 24, is not required to travel to America to attend the October 2 hearing and also had an option to settle the fine before it got to court. He is now expected to link up with the Belgium national team as planned and take a full part in the international break. The £75million striker was given a citation by police back in July just before he agreed his deal to United. The arrest was over a rowdy party at his rented holiday home in Beverly Hills during his summer holidays in the States. FFA Centre of Excellence 12 (Jay Barnett 8’, Charlie Mavros 19’, 44’, Lleyton Brooks 53’, 63’, Mirza Muratovic 65’, 71’, Lous D’Arrigo 77’, 80’, Kai Trewin 82’, James Fletcher 83’, 88’)def. Riverina Rhinos 0 The FFA Centre of Excellence did their bit to keep in touch with Canberra Olympic on Saturday with a 12-goal thumping of the Riverina Rhinos at the AIS. Jay Barnett got the youngsters underway after just eight minutes with a good finish, before Charlie Mavros got his first of the afternoon just over ten minutes later to leave the visitors reeling early. The CoE continued to pile on the pressure throughout the half and Mavros completed his brace on the brink of the interval to give the hosts a three-goal lead at the break.
